This procurement will establish a contract for capacity services at 20 Gbps between Dublin and London. It is being conducted under teh 2006 Regulations in the form of an Open Procedure and Dante is seeking solution proposals and pricing for layer 2, multiple 10 Gbps circuits to refresh the connectivity to the Republic of Ireland. Connectivity for the Republic of Ireland's NREN HEAnet, is delivered through two diverse links. One of these (provided in partnership with the English NREN, Janet) will remain and the scope of this procurement is for a replacement to the other existing link. This is required to be diverse from the Janet link and once implemented will provide 20 Gbps of protected capacity. The contract that may be awarded from this procurement will run for a maximum term of 3 years and will allow for increases in capacity in 10 Gbps increments. Dante may in the life of the contract require the London end of the Service to be shifted to Telectiy Manchester. Bidders are required to identify prices/options for doing this as part of their offer.
